Marty Supreme (out Jan 22) could finally be the film which wins Timothée Chalamet his first Academy Award. Set in the 1950s, he plays an arrogant American ping pong player who will "screw" anyone over (family, friends, colleagues) to get ahead. He's intensely unlikeable... but you still respect his hustle. Love the music score and it's got one of the best acting ensembles of the year. Grade: A-.
